What Causes Dandruff Anyway?

Before understanding why ketoconazole shampoo works better, it’s essential to grasp what dandruff actually is. Dandruff isn’t just dry skin—it’s often triggered by an overgrowth of a fungus called Malassezia. This fungus naturally lives on your scalp, feeding off oils secreted by hair follicles. When it grows out of control, it irritates the scalp, causing increased cell turnover. The result? Flakes, irritation, and that dreaded persistent itch.

Regular Anti-Dandruff Shampoos: Temporary Solutions?

Most regular anti-dandruff shampoos contain ingredients like zinc pyrithione, coal tar, or selenium sulfide. These substances primarily aim to reduce scalp inflammation and remove visible flakes. However, they don’t always address the root cause—fungal overgrowth. Because they mainly tackle symptoms, their effectiveness diminishes soon after use. Users often find themselves washing their hair daily to keep dandruff in check, only for it to return rapidly after skipping a wash.

In short, these shampoos offer immediate but temporary relief. The more persistent your dandruff, the less effective these shampoos become over time.

How to Use Ketoconazole Shampoo Effectively

To get the most out of your ketoconazole shampoo, apply it to wet hair and gently massage it into the scalp. Allow it to sit for three to five minutes to enable the active ingredient to work, then rinse thoroughly. Dermatologists typically recommend using ketoconazole shampoo twice weekly for about four weeks initially, and then once weekly or every two weeks for maintenance.
